Definition
The Lifting Mechanism is a critical component of the Automated Chemical Drum Agitation and Homogenization System, responsible for vertically positioning chemical drums to engage with the agitation head. It ensures precise alignment and controlled movement during loading, processing, and unloading phases, facilitating efficient mixing and homogenization of chemical contents while maintaining operational safety and repeatability. The mechanism operates through a motor-driven actuator, such as a lead screw, hydraulic cylinder, or chain drive, converting rotational or linear input into controlled vertical motion. Guidance systems, including rails or columns, maintain stability and precision during lifting and lowering cycles, with sensors providing feedback for position control. Typical specifications include a lifting speed of 0.05–0.15 mm/s, a lifting height of 500–1500 mm, positioning accuracy of ±0.5 mm, motor power of 0.75–2.2 kW, and load capacity of 500–2000 kg. The mechanism is available in stainless steel (AISI 304/316), carbon steel, or aluminum alloy, with an ingress protection rating of IP54–IP65, operating temperature range of -10 to 60 °C, and supply voltage of 380–480 V AC (three-phase, 50/60 Hz). It complies with relevant standards such as IEC 60529 for ingress protection, IEC 60038 for voltage, ASTM A240 for stainless steel, GB/T 3098.11 for guide rails, and ISO 3744 for noise measurement. The operating pressure is 1.0–1.6 MPa, and the noise level is ≤75 dB(A) at 1 m under load. The footprint is adjustable from 800×800 to 1200×1200 mm. Working Principle
The lifting mechanism uses a motor-driven actuator, such as a lead screw, hydraulic cylinder, or chain drive, to convert rotational or linear input into controlled vertical motion. A guidance system, typically consisting of rails or columns, ensures stability and precision during lifting and lowering cycles. Sensors provide feedback for position control, allowing precise alignment with the agitation head. The mechanism is designed to handle loads up to 2000 kg and operates within specified speed and height ranges. Safety features and repeatability are achieved through controlled motion and feedback systems.

Reliability & Engineering Risk Analysis

Failure Mode & Root Cause
Wire rope fatigue and strand breakage
Cause: Cyclic loading beyond design limits, improper spooling causing kinks, or corrosion from environmental exposure
Hydraulic cylinder seal failure and fluid leakage
Cause: Contaminated hydraulic fluid, excessive pressure spikes, or seal degradation from temperature extremes and chemical exposure
Maintenance Indicators
  • Unusual grinding or scraping noises during operation indicating mechanical interference or bearing failure
  • Visible hydraulic fluid leaks at cylinder seals or connection points, especially with pressure drops during lifting
Engineering Tips
  • Implement regular non-destructive testing (NDT) like magnetic particle inspection on critical load-bearing components to detect subsurface flaws before catastrophic failure
  • Establish a preventive maintenance schedule with lubrication management, alignment checks, and load testing at 125% of rated capacity annually to verify structural integrity
